- 博客(6)
- 收藏
- 关注
原创 换教室[NOIP提高组2016]概率dp入门
洛谷链接没有链接描述题意牛牛有n个时间段要上课,第i节课可以选择在ci教室或者di教室上课,初始默认 在ci教室,牛牛最多能提交m节课的换课申请,即把原本在ci的课换到di上,对于第i个时间段的换课申请有ki的概率成功,牛牛必须同时提交所有的换课申请,而不能根据别的课成功与否更换申请。牛牛的大学有v个教室和e条路,每节课下课的时候他必须从这个教室走到下节课的教室去,每条路有一个劳累值,牛牛会选择一条劳累值最低的路走。现在牛牛希望下学期的劳累值的期望最小,请问要怎么提交换课申请能使劳累值期望最小,输
2021-08-20 15:45:21 120
原创 sos dp 题解备忘
用于遗忘sos dp后快速回忆和练习题一添加链接描述题目大意给你1e5个数(可重复),定义两个数的二进制位不包含即为一组,问给定的数中一共有多少组数满足这个条件。二进制位不包含即两个数都至少有一位是对方没有的。分析对于每一个数,只考虑比它大的数,就可以避免重复计算。因此只需要考虑有多少个数是包含这个数的,所以dp[i]表示:(a[x]&i)==i的a[x]的个数只需要用剩下的数减去这个数就是当前的数能够增加的组数,注意数可能重复。代码#include<bits/stdc++
2021-04-08 21:12:02 181 1
原创 SOS DP 练习题集
SOS DP 练习题集CF div2 1208FCF div2 E Compatible NumbersCF div1 E VowelsCovering SetsCF div1 D Jzzhu and NumbersCF div1 D Varying Kibibits
2021-04-06 16:10:12 187
原创 【CSDN自动发评论】无情的发评论机器——爬虫小试验
【CSDN自动发评论】无情的发评论机器——爬虫小试验前言昨天在学AC自动机的时候,做到一道题,搜题解的时候,看到了一篇非常好的博客:传送门看完之后不禁觉得,写的真是太好了,再仔细一看,居然是我的学姐写的耶,于是就想在评论区给学姐捧捧场,发点什么好呢,发个“太强了”吧。这个时候我正好开着抓包工具(怎么可能啊QAQ),然后就抓到了这样一个包难道——这该不会——这莫非怀着激动的心情我往上翻了翻果然,这是一个post请求,也就是说,我的发评论的操作,竟然是由这个请求完成的!(假装震惊0.0)既
2021-03-10 14:59:33 2111 21
原创 【模拟退火】小学六年级必学经典
【泰勒公式】f(x)=f(a)+f′(x−a)/1!∗(x−a)+...f(x)=f(a)+f'(x-a)/1!*(x-a)+...f(x)=f(a)+f′(x−a)/1!∗(x−a)+...刚看了二十分钟泰勒公式,这就来写个退火的开头。【例题】众所周知,lwh很怕冷,现在在一个房间内,有n台空调,lwh当然想和空调们靠的更近。现在给出每台空调的坐标,求一个点,使lwh与所有空调的距离的和最小,输出最小的距离和。这道题不用退火当然也能做,甚至用退火做也不一定能算退火,作为例题主要是为了让保洁阿姨也
2020-12-28 18:25:20 545 6
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人